Ingredients

3/4 cup gluten-free breadcrumbs
1 cup rice milk
1 lb ground turkey
1 teaspoon basil
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on garlic sal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 cup parmesan cheese
1/2 cup green bell pepper
1/4 cup onion
Meatloaf is a classic comfort food that many people grew up with, but traditional meatloaf recipes are often high in fat and carbs. These mini meatloaves offer a healthier alternative that is both gluten-free and easy to make. The secret to making these meatloaves tender and flavorful is the addition of rice milk and Parmesan cheese. Paired with a side of roasted vegetables or a fresh salad, these meatloaves make a tasty and nutritious dinner option.

Instructions

1.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
2.In a large mixing bowl, combine the breadcrumbs and rice milk and let the mixture sit for 5 minutes until the breadcrumbs absorb the milk.
3.Add the ground turkey, basil, salt, garlic salt, black pepper, and Parmesan cheese to the mixing bowl. Use a wooden spoon or your hands to mix the ingredients until well combined.
4.Mix in the green bell pepper and onion.
5.Use a 1/2 cup measuring cup to scoop out the meat mixture and form it into mini meatloaves on a baking sheet.
6.Bake the meatloaves for 30-35 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165 degrees F.

PROS

These mini meatloaves are a delicious and convenient meal option that is both gluten-free and easy to make.

They are a good source of protein and low in fat compared to traditional meatloaf recipes.

CONS

These meatloaves may be dry if overcooked, so it’s important to monitor the internal temperature to ensure they are cooked properly.

They also require breadcrumbs and Parmesan cheese, which may not be suitable for individuals with dairy or gluten allergies.

HEALTH & BENEFITS

These meatloaves are a good source of protein, which is essential for building and repairing muscles and tissues.
The green bell pepper and onion add a good dose of vitamins and minerals, including vitamin C and potassium. Additionally, this recipe is low in fat and gluten-free, making it an excellent choice for individuals with dietary restrictions.
